Probóscide, the snout or trunke of an Elephant.
Probóstide, as Probóscide.
Próbro, any reprochfull act.
Probróso, reprochfull, infamous.
Procácchia, the hearbe Purcelane.
Procacciánte, procuring. Also a procurer. Also a shifting companion.
Procacciáre, to procure, to shift for, to endeuour to get and obtaine.
PRO Procacciatóre, a procurer, a shifter for.
Procaccíno, a broker or procurer for others. Also a shifter for himselfe.
Procáccio, an ordinarie poste or carier, namely hee that goeth between Rome and Naples. Also a procuring, a procurement, a shifting or canuasing for. Also industrie, labour, diligence, and studie to obtaine.
